The image displays a watercolor painting, framed in light brown wood with a white mat, mounted on a plain white wall within an exhibition space. The scene is located in São Paulo, Brazil, as indicated by an informational plaque identifying the artwork as a "project for allegory of the Passarela do Samba SPAM, 2014," from the "Acervo Museu de Arte Naïf."

The artwork itself depicts a stylized, dark-skinned figure with a bald head and white markings on its face, rendered in profile facing right. The figure is smoking a pipe and appears to carry a small, lighter-skinned figure on its back. Its left arm holds a woven basket, while its right hand is raised with the palm open. The figure stands on a rectangular pedestal. The word "IRANDLAND" is visibly written on the front of the pedestal, possibly accompanied by an illegible symbol below it.

Below the framed artwork, a white rectangular plaque provides contextual information in Portuguese, identifying the piece as "Figura pré-colombiana, projeto para alegoria da Passarela do Samba SPAM, 2014," specifying the medium as "aquarela sobre papel" (watercolor on paper), and attributing it to the "Acervo Museu de Arte Naïf" (Naïf Art Museum Collection) with rights by "Maria Laranjeira." Faint reflections of other framed artworks are discernible in the glass covering the displayed painting. No individuals are visible in the immediate foreground of the image.
